NGOs Under Challenge: Dynamics and Drawbacks in Development
----------------------------------------------------------------
Edited by: Farhad Hossain & Susanna Myllyl�
Published by: Ministry for Foreign Affairs of Finland, Department for
International Development Cooperation, Helsinki 1998.
This book discusses the current issues of democracy, civil society, human
rights, marginalised people and environment in the NGO development work.
It also aims at contributing to the further development of the theories on
NGOs in development.
